When I visited China last october, part of the trip took me to several villages around Kaiping City in SE China, and the standard of living in those areas is disconcerning to say the least.

As a student of real estate in the US and having talked with residents in the area, it is my understanding that farmers do not get to keep the entire crop for the year.  With rice for instance, the government gets the first one, and farmers keep the second.  It is also my understanding that farmers do not own their own land, rather it is owned by "agricultural collectives" and they have a "right of use" to farm that land.

If you want to increase the standard of living for rural residents in china, you need to extend the market reforms of deng xiaoping.  That is, you need to allow farmers to keep what they produce and allow them to sell it on the open market.  You should also allow for the furtherence of individual property rights in rural areas.  With that in place, it will unleash the potential of your rural population to create new wealth for themselves and your country.
